Karnali Highway blocked due to landslides

JUMLA, July 7: Vehicular traffic on the Karnali Highway has been obstructed due to a landslide that occurred at Hulma of Kalikot district.


Similarly, works are in progress to open various sections of the highway blocked due to landslides. The highway was blocked at Timure, Galje and Pili among other places in Tilagupha Municipality due to flooding and landslides following incessant rains. 


Works are being carried out to resume traffic on the highway by the evening today, said Chitra Chaulagain, the Information Officer at the Division Road Office, Jumla.

The major five highways in Karnali Province – the Karnali, the Mid-hill, the Madan Bhandari, the Rapti and the Bheri Corridor – are obstructed due to landslides.


Karnali Province Police Office said that the Karnali Highway is blocked at four places, the Mid-hills highway at four places, the Rapti highway at two places, the Madan Bhandari highway at one place and the Bheri Corridor highway at three places due to landslides and floods.


The passengers traveling by these highways have been stranded for two days.


Jayaprithvi highway obstructed


Similarly, a report from Bajhang said the Jaya Prithvi Highway has been obstructed due to a landslide triggered by incessant rainfall since Friday.  The highway has been blocked since Saturday due to the occurrence of a landslide at Khodpe near the Bajhang and Baitadi border. Chief District Officer of Bajhang, Bishwamitra Kuinkel, said that efforts are on to open the highway through coordination between the two districts – Bajhang and Baitadi.
